Subject: Date localization rollout — heads up

Hi Quillbridge partners,

Welcome to the new folks! Quick note: our Fernwheel scheduler now localizes date formats per the user's locale header instead of defaulting to day-month-year. If your integration parses our confirmation payloads, switch to the ISO timestamp field — the display string will vary. Everything else is unchanged. To test against the localization sandbox, send requests with the token below.

portal login ticket: eyJhbGciOiJIUzI1NiIsInR5cCI6IkpXVCJ9.eyJzdWIiOiIwEOsktwVNwIn0.-UJU3fdyyCgG

**Ticket #—: Tide-table widget showing yesterday's tides**

Hey folks — a few Shorecast users report the tide-table widget is stuck on yesterday's data after midnight until a manual refresh. Fix is ready (cache key now includes local date), just needs sign-off before we ship to the beta channel. Waiting on approval from the person below.

approver of fafog-hagug = Sorox Druiel Zorox Tamix

To: Dispatch Desk
Subject: Water samples — Grenholt Reservoir

Twelve chilled sample bottles from the Grenholt Reservoir intake are packed and ready in cooler box 4. Chain-of-custody forms are inside the lid sleeve; records team must countersign on receipt. Samples expire for lab purposes at 14:00, so no stops en route. Keep the cooler upright and unopened. Temperature logger is active. The hand-over for the courier is specified below.

courier memo of yawep-yafog: the pramir ulaix courier leaves the ulavan aldix frair zorok oliiel joreth rusdor fenvan ledger at gate 1305 under passcode 514738

Internal Memo — Branch Managers

We are introducing a new mid-level subscription tier, Corvid Plus, effective next quarter. It sits between Corvid Basic and Corvid Premier, adding priority servicing and quarterly account reviews. Pricing sheets and training materials will reach branches within two weeks. Please hold customer announcements until head office confirms timing. For context, leadership has shared the following note on our broader plans.

management briefing: Project Ulavan slips by two quarters because of the staffing delay.